Eda was home alone, Luz had taken King to the park. She was mindlessly going through her scroll as another announcement video of The Day of Unity came onto the screen. Raine was there. She looked at them longingly, ignoring everything but them, wishing that they could remember who they are and be with her again. The leader of the plant coven gave them a horn of some kind of liquid. She figured out that that drink is what's been brainwashing them a while ago. It pains her to see them take it up to their mouth. Then they blew on it!? It didn't look hot at all? Then she bolted upright. They weren't blowing they were whistling!! They weren't brainwashed at all! They were faking it the whole time!! That troll! She was furious at them but couldn't stay that way for long, she loved them too much, but that doesn't mean that she won't yell at them about this when they finally meet. She sighed, knowing that she couldn't do that either. She knew they had their reasons no matter how stupid they were.

The first thing she needed to do was make sure she was right, and she knew just how to do it. She opened Luz's hexagram account, She did her best not to look at anything. Even though she made it on her scroll, it was Luz's account, so she decided to give her that space to be with her friends. Luckily, she was able to find the messaging part quickly. She found and opened her chat with Hunter, trying not to look at their existing chat, she sent him a message pretending to be Luz.

"Hey Hunter, there's a bard joke that's been going around Hexside that no one will explain to me can you ask Raine if they know what it means?"

"Ok, sure what is it?"

"Only a bat knows how to whistle"

"Yeah, that doesn't make any sense, but I'll see if they know what it means. I think I know where they are."

Ball's in your court now Rainstorm.

Hunter approached Raine's room, they were playing their violin, so he knew they were there. He knocked, and they said they could come in, they had put down their instrument.

"How can I help you, Hunter?" they asked.

"Luz said that there's a bard joke that she doesn't get but wants to know if you do?" Raine started to get anxious again and tried to hide it. Luz is too close to Eda.

"Wh-what's the joke?"

The boy took out his scroll to make sure he read it right. "Only a bat knows how to whistle," He read. So many emotions flooded their mind. Eda knew. In the back of their mind, they knew she would figure everything out, she was smart that way and in every other way.

"It means a bat has nothing to lose," they chose their words carefully.

A confused Hunter messaged "Luz."

Eda stared at her scroll in disbelief, they're doing the self-sacrificing bull shit, Eda typed out her reply, which a confused Hunter read.

"you don't need to be a bat to be willing to whistle for those they care about?"

"Hunter? Can I borrow that?" Raine asked referring to the scroll. The boy gave it to them, knowing that this was not about a school joke.

"That's why I didn't want to tell you Eda, you have kids that need you"

"People that love you" they added.

"Well I love you Raine and I don't want to lose you for a third time," tears formed in Eda's eyes. "I'll talk to my kids to see if this is worth it, WHEN they agree, which they will, we'll talk again," there was a short pause,

"You know no one knows how to get out of trouble like I do Rainstorm." Raine was getting teary as well, they wish that they could be in Eda's arms once again.

They looked up at Hunter who was staring at them.

"Is there a way to delete messages?" they asked awkwardly beating themselves up over not thinking about that earlier.

"I don't think so..."

After a moment of thought, they responded, "don't read it and show this Darius and no one else and do what he says."

The boy nodded and followed orders. Raine didn't want to push this off onto the abomination leader, but he knew Hunter, and the plan better.
